Similar to many others I've found searching this issue, I tried to order a new phone on the website.  As a long time existing customer, I used the "My Verizon" app on my phone.  It would not give me the trade in value listed of $1,000, so I instead called customer service.  Customer Service informed me that the phone was eligible and I would receive the full trade in value of $1,000, but it would appear as a credit on my bill in 1 or 2 billing cycles.  Customer Service placed the order for me over the phone.  Aside from this order being an absolute nightmare on several fronts, necessitating several phone calls just to get the phone, and NEVER getting the charger I paid for, I received an email today telling me that my "actual trade-in value had to be adjusted."  It advised that "Your plan does not qualify" was the reason.  They then called the advertised $1,000 trade-in value an "Estimated" value, and "adjusted" it from $1,000 to $49.50!  

Wait a second:  Verizon was then and is now and at all times was my carrier.  They knew -- then and now -- what plan I had.  Now, suddenly, once they receive the phone, my plan somehow doesn't qualify???  I would like this attended to, please.  Also, the second phone I traded in was sent at the same time at the UPS Store, but Verizon claims not to have received it yet.  What is going on at Verizon lately?  I can't afford to spend hours on end on the phone just to get what I contracted to receive.  This was NOT part of the deal!

Hi, I had the same issue and was online with tech support today.  Ordered the new iphone 16 plus and an unlimited plus myPlan, and it shows this on the receipt and in the monthly bill as well. Then when I traded in the phone it said my plan wasn't eligible. Something thinks that I am on my old Do More Unlimited plan or something, but not the billing or receipt system. so what gives?

Anyway, I have all the paperwork that shows the phone was ordered on the same date as the plan was changed to Unlimited Plus (because that is what the website does so you get the offer) and this needs to be corrected. Talked to Verizon support today and they said I would have to wait a month and then contact them again to fix this. Wish they could do this sooner though and change my trade in value back to the $830 as promised instead of the $17 it went down to.
